I sistemi operativi basati nantu à u nucleo di Linux tipicamente ingannanu un gran numaru di cartulari vuotu è micca vuoto. Certi di elli occupanu una quantità abbastanza grande di u spaziu in u drive, è dinò diventanu spessu inutili. In stu casu, a scelta curretta sarebbe quella di rimuoverli. Ci hè parechje maniere di fà una pulizia, ognuna di esse applicabile in una situazione certa. Fighjate tutti i metudi dispunibili in più dettagliu, è sceglite u più adeguatu in i vostri bisogni.
Togliete le directory in Linux
In questu articulu parleremu di utilità di console, è di attrezzi addiziunali chì sò lanciati attraverso l'entrata di cume. Tuttavia, ùn si deve micca scurdà chì e distribuzioni grafiche sò spessu implementate in distribuzioni. Di conseguenza, per sguassà un annuariu, ghjustu bisognu di andà finu à questu per mezu di u gestore di file, cliccate à dirittu destro nantu à l'icona è selezziunate "Elimina". Dopu à ciò, ùn vi scurdate di sguassà u canastu. Tuttavia, questa opzione ùn hè micca applicabile per tutti l'utenti, cusì vi vogliu cun amparà à familiarizzà cù i seguenti manuali.
Prima di cuminciare à cunsiderà i modi, hè impurtante notate chì quandu si inserisce un comando, spicisce più spessu u nome di a cartella che si desidera cancellà. Quandu ùn sì micca in a so posizione, devi specificà u chjassu cumpletu. S'ellu ci hè una sì una opportunità, vi pruponiamo di truvà u repertoriu genitore di l'oggiu è andatelu per esse via a console. Questa azzione hè eseguita in solu pochi minuti:
- Aprite u gestore di file è naviga finu à a posizione di conservazione di a cartella.
- Cliccate nant'à u clicchjone è seleziona "Pruprietà".
- In a sezione "Basic" truvate u parcorsu cumpletu è ricordati.
- Avviate a console via u menù o aduprà a chiave d'accessu standard Ctrl + Alt + T.
- Usate cddi andà à travaglià in u locu. Poi a linea di entrata assume a forma
cd / home / user / folder
è hè attivatu dopu prughjettu à a tasca Enter. Utente in stu casu, u username, è cartella - u nome di u cartulare parent.
Se ùn avete micca a capacità di determinà a situazione, quandu vi rimuete duverete inserìte a chjama piena, allora dovete sapè.
Metudu 1: Comandi di Terminal Standard
In a shell shell di ogni distribuzione Linux, ci hè un set di utilità di basa è di strumenti chì vi permettenu di effettuà una varietà di azzioni cù i parametri di u sistema è i file, cumprendu l'eliminazione di directory. Ci sò parechje pratiche è ognunu hè cusì utile quant'à una situazione certa.
Mandatu Rmdir
Prima di tutti mi piaci à tocca à rmdir. Hè prughjettu per pulì u sistema solu da cartulari vacanti. Li rimuove in permanenza, è u vantaghju di questu strumentu hè a simplicità di a so sintassi è l'absenza di errori. In a console, abbastanza per registràrmdir cartella
dove cartella - nome di u cartulare in a situazione attuale. L'utunile hè attivatu premendu a tasca. Enter.
Nulla vi impedisce di specificà u chjassu cumpletu per a directory se ùn pudete navigà à a posizione richiesta o ùn ci hè bisognu. Allora a stringa prende, per esempiu, a forma seguente:rmdir / home / user / folder / folder1
dove usatore - username cartella - directory parente, è folder1 - cartulare da eliminà. Per piacè, avà a nota chì ci deve esse una slash prima di a casa, è deve esse assente à a fine di u caminu.
Rm comando
L'utellu precedente hè unu di i componenti di l'utilità rm. Inizialmente, hè disegnatu per sguassà i file, ma se lu date l'argumentu adeguatu, si cancelli a cartella. Questu opzione hè gia adatta per i cartulari micca vuoti, in a console chì avete bisognu di entràrm-R folder
(o cartulare cumpleta). Nota l'argumentu -R - Iniziona l'eliminazione recursiva, chì vogliu riguardu tuttu u cuntenutu di a cartella è di per sè. Hè necessariu tene cusu in cunsite quandu si entri -r - hè una opzione cumplettamente diversa.
Se vulete visualizzare una lista di tutti i file eliminati è cartulari quandu usanu rm, allora avete bisognu di cambià u linea un pocu. Entrate in "Terminal"rm -Rfv folder
è dopu attivate u comando.
Dopu chì a cancellazione hè cumpleta, verrà visualizzata l'infurmazione nantu à tutti i cartulari è l'ogni individui situati in precedenza in una posizione specifica.
Trova comando
U nostru situ hà dighjà materiale cù esempi di l'usu di a ricerca in i sistemi operativi sviluppati nantu à u kernel Linux. Benintesa, ci hè solu infurmazione basica è più utile. Pudete familiarizzarti cun u cliccatu nant'à u ligame chì seguita, è ora vi propemu di scopre cumu questu strumentu funziona quandu avete bisognu di cancellà e cartine.
Leggi ancu: Esempii d'usu di u comando find in Linux
- Comu hè cunnisciutu truvate serve per ricercà oggetti in u sistema. Attraversu l'usu di opzioni addizionali, pudete truvà cartulari cù un nome particulare è li rimuovere immediatamente. Per fà quessa, entrate in a console
truvate. -tipu di u nomu "cartella" -exec rm -rf {};
- nome di u catalogu. Assicuratevi di scrive e virgulette. - Talvolta una linea separata mostra l'infurmazioni chì ùn ci sò micca tali file o directory, ma quessa ùn significa chì ùn era micca trovu. Just truvate Ci hà fattu di più una volta dopu cancellazione di u catalogu da u sistema.
truvate ~ / -empty -type d -delete
permette di sguassà tutte e cartelle vuote in u sistema. Alcuni di elli sò dispunibili solu à u superusu, cusì prima truvate Duvà aghjunghjesudo
.- A schermata mostra i dati nantu à tutti l'ogni trovu è u successu di l'operazione.
- Pudete ancu specificà solu una directory specifica in chì l'utellu cercarà è pulisce. Allora a string hè esposta, per esempiu, cumu:
truvà / home / user / Folder / -empty -type d -delete
.
Questu cumpleta l'interazione cù e utilità di a console standard in Linux. Comu pudete vede, ci hè un gran numaru di elli è ognunu hè applicabile in certe situazioni. Sì avete un desideru di cunniscialu cù altre squadre popolari, leghje u nostru materiale separatu nantu à u ligame sottu.
Vede ancu: Comandi frequenti in Terminal Linux
Metudu 2: U pulitu di l'utilità
Se l'utenti anziani sò integrati in a shell shell, allora l'upplicazione di pulitura bisognu installà u so propriu repository ufficiali. U so vantaghju hè chì permette di sguassà in permanenza u catalogu senza a pussibilità di a so risturmentu cù un prugrammu spiciali.
- Aprite "Terminal" è scrivite quì
sudo apt install install wipe
. - Inserite a password per confermà u vostru contu.
- Aspetta chì i nuovi pacchetti da aghjunghjendu à e librerie di sistema.
- Ùn manca solu per andà à u locu desideratu o abbità u cumandamentu cù u chjassu cumpletu per a cartella. Sembra questu:
pulisce -rfi / home / user / folder
o soluasciugare -rfi cartella
à e prestazioni preliminaricd + path
.
Sì cun travagliu in u strumentu asciugate avia a furtuna per prima volta, scrive in a consolepulisce-aiuta
uttene infurmazioni nantu à aduprà questu utilità da i sviluppatori. Una descrizione di ogni argumentu è opzione sarà visualizata quì.
Adesso avete a voglia di cumandà i cumanduli terminali chì permettenu di cancellà i directory senza u vuoto o di i directory senza u sguardo nantu à i sistemi operativi sviluppati nantu à Linux. Comu pudete vede, ogni strumentu presentatu funziona in modi diversi, è cusì ottimale in diverse situazioni. Prima di esecuzione di l'utili, cunsiglii fermamente di verificà a curretta di u nomu di chjassu è cartulare specificatu in modo chì errori o eliminazioni accidentali ùn accadini.